About Howell Recreation Youth Sports
The Howell Area Parks & Recreation Authority’s Youth Sports Program is designed to allow youth the opportunity to participate in various sporting activities in a non-competitive environment. All athletes get an equal amount of attention and playing time regardless of ability. All programs are first-come, first-served. Programs can fill to capacity before the deadline. Teams are formed based off registration details: practice day preference, time preference, coach, etc.
Please note: Any teams without a coach (teams titled Coach *NEEDED*) at the close of registration will be merged into existing teams, which may increase roster sizes.

CO-ED SPECIFIC RULES
Co-Ed ball may be hit directly across by either male or female team members but if there is more than one hit, a female must touch the ball before it goes over.
Co-Ed Inter-Change is allowed. Back row male may block but not attack.
Co-Ed Leagues – if your team contacts the ball more than once (after the block) to send it over the net, a female must contact the ball.
Teams will consist of a maximum of 6 players (3 men and 3 women) to a minimum of 3 players. You can have more women than men playing on the court but there is a maximum of 3 men players.
